When he suffered a traumatic brain injury in a 1985 bicycling accident, artist and teacher John Sears encountered physical and emotional obstacles that challenged his spirit and his ability to make art. This exhibit will chronicle his journey as an artist. It will include drawings and paintings created both before and after his injury, illustrating his approach to life and to art: “Contrast is the Key.”
